jQWidgets jqxGrid cellclick事件

jQWidgets 是一个流行的 JavaScript UI 库,提供了许多可定制的 UI 组件。其中一个组件是 jqxGrid,它是一个用于显示和编辑表格数据的控件。jqxGrid 提供多个事件,其中之一是 cellclick。下面是关于 jqxGridcellclick 事件的详攻:

cellclick 事件概述

cellclick 事件在用户单击单元格时触发。该事件提供了单元格的行和列索引,以及单元格的值。可以使用该事件来执行单元格级别的操作,例如显示详细信息或编辑单元格。

cellclick 事件示例

下面是两个例,如何使用 cellclick 事件:

示例 1:显示单元格值

// 创建 jqxGrid 实例
var myGrid = $("#myGrid").jqxGrid({
    // 其他属性
});

// 绑定 cellclick 事件
myGrid.on("cellclick", function(event) {
    // 获取单元格的行和列索引
    var row = event.args.rowindex;
    var column = event.args.columnindex;

    // 获取单元格的值
    var value = myGrid.jqxGrid("getcellvalue", row, column);

    // 显示单元格的值
    alert("单元格的值是:" + value);
});

在上面的示例中,我们创建了一个 jqxGrid 实例,并绑定了 cellclick 事件。当用户单击单元格时,该事件将获取单元格的行和列索引,以及单元格的值,并将其显示在一个警告框中。

示例 2:编辑单元格

// 创建 jqxGrid 实例
var myGrid = $("#myGrid").jqxGrid({
    // 其他属性
});

// 绑定 cellclick 事件
myGrid.on("cellclick", function(event) {
    // 获取单元格的行和列索引
    var row = event.args.rowindex;
    var column = event.args.columnindex;

    // 编辑单元格
    myGrid.jqxGrid("begincelledit", row, column);
});

在上面的示例中,我们创建了一个 jqxGrid 实例,并绑定了 cellclick 事件。当用户单击单元格时,该事件将获取单元格的行和列索引,并使用 begincelledit 方法来编辑单元格。

结论

jqxGridcellclick 事件是一个非常有用的事件,可以用于执行单元格级别的操作。通过上面的示例,您应该了解了如何使用该事件。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QWidgets jqxGrid cellclick事件 - Python技术站

(0)
上一篇 2023年5月11日
下一篇 2023年5月11日

相关文章

  • jQWidgets jqxMenu animationHideDuration属性

    以下是关于 jQWidgets jqxMenu 组件中 animationHideDuration 属性的详细攻略。 jQWidgets jqxMenu animationHideDuration 属性 jQWidgets jqxMenu 组件的 animationHideDuration 属性用于设置菜单隐藏时的动画持续时间该默认值为 150 毫秒。 语法…

    jquery 2023年5月12日
    00
  • jQuery Mobile Column-Toggle Table columnBtnTheme选项

    jQuery Mobile提供了一个实用的列切换(Column-Toggle)功能,允许用户在小屏幕设备上仅显示他们想查看的数据列。 columnBtnTheme选项是这个功能的一部分,允许用户设置列切换按钮的主题。 该功能通常用于响应式设计,以使表格适用于不同的屏幕宽度。下面是如何在jQuery Mobile中使用列切换表格并设置columnBtnThem…

    jquery 2023年5月12日
    00
  • 如何用jQuery/JavaScript来比较两个JavaScript数组对象

    当比较两个JavaScript数组对象时,我们可以使用jQuery/JavaScript的库来帮助我们完成比较。下面是一个完整的比较JavaScript数组对象的攻略,包括过程和示例说明。 1. 首先,使用jQuery的$.grep()方法过滤两个数组 我们可以使用jQuery库的$.grep()方法来过滤两个数组。这种方法会把第一个数组中具有相同属性的对象…

    jquery 2023年5月12日
    00
  • jquery数组封装使用方法分享(jquery数组遍历)

    来讲解一下“jquery数组封装使用方法分享(jquery数组遍历)”的完整攻略。 标题 在介绍该内容之前,我们先来设定主题的标题。 # jquery数组封装使用方法分享(jquery数组遍历) 什么是jquery数组? Jquery数组指使用jQuery库中提供的方法对JavaScript数组进行封装的一种方式。jQuery库中提供了一些简化开发的便利方法…

    jquery 2023年5月27日
    00
  • Jquery.Form 异步提交表单的简单实例

    接下来我将向您介绍如何使用jQuery.Form实现异步提交表单。 什么是jQuery.Form? jQuery Form插件是一款轻量级的表单提交插件,可以进行异步提交表单,并且支持数据序列化、文件上传以及多种回调函数等。 引入jQuery Form插件 首先,我们需要在网页中引入jQuery的核心库和jQuery.Form插件。 <script s…

    jquery 2023年5月28日
    00
  • JQuery的$命名冲突详细解析

    JQuery的$命名冲突详细解析 在Javascript中,$符号通常表示jQuery对象,可以用来方便地选择DOM元素、添加事件监听器、执行动画效果等。但有时候会遇到$符号被其他库或浏览器自带的函数占用的情况,引起命名冲突。本文将详细讲解JQuery的$命名冲突问题,并提供几个解决方案。 命名冲突的原因 其他库使用$符号 有些其他的Javascript库(…

    jquery 2023年5月27日
    00
  • 如何在单个jQuery移动文档中包含多个页面

    当我们在Web开发中需要在单个jQuery移动文档中包含多个页面时,我们可以使用jQuery Mobile框架。下面是一个详细的攻略,包含两个示例说明。 步骤 引入jQuery Mobile框架 在HTML文档的<head>标签中,需要引入jQuery Mobile框架的CSS和JavaScript文件。使用CDN或本地文件进行引入。以下是一个示…

    jquery 2023年5月9日
    00
  • 详细介绍jQuery.outerWidth() 函数具体用法

    当我们需要获取一个元素的外部宽度时,可以使用jQuery提供的outerWidth()函数。下面对这个函数具体的用法进行详细介绍: 语法 $(selector).outerWidth([includeMargin]); selector:必选参数,用于指定要操作的元素。 includeMargin:可选参数,一个布尔值,表示是否将元素的margin值计算在内…

    jquery 2023年5月28日
    00
合作推广
合作推广
分享本页
返回顶部